What is a Mood Board?
A mood board is a collage of images and ideas that captures the style and mood you want to achieve in a makeover.
Mood boards help you organise your inspiration and clarify your total look vision
Includes
Hair design
Face paint and make up
Nail design
Outfit.

Why Use a Mood Board?
Mood boards allow you to experiment creatively and communicate your ideas effectively to others before starting the makeover process.

How to Build a Mood Board
Collect images, magazine cuttings, colour swatches, product photos, and accessory ideas.
Reflect your chosen style.
